# Copyright (C) 2022 The Qt Company Ltd.
# SPDX-License-Identifier: LicenseRef-Qt-Commercial OR LGPL-3.0-only OR GPL-2.0-only OR GPL-3.0-only
from pathlib import Path
import configparser
from configparser import ConfigParser
import shutil
import logging
from project import ProjectData
from .commands import run_qmlimportscanner
# Some QML plugins like QtCore are excluded from this list as they don't contribute much to
# executable size. Excluding them saves the extra processing of checking for them in files
EXCLUDED_QML_PLUGINS = {"QtQuick", "QtQuick3D", "QtCharts", "QtWebEngine", "QtTest", "QtSensors"}
class Config:
"""
Wrapper class around config file, whose options are used to control the executable creation
"""
def __init__(self, config_file: Path, source_file: Path, python_exe: Path, dry_run: bool):
self.config_file = config_file
self.parser = ConfigParser(comment_prefixes="/", allow_no_value=True)
if not self.config_file.exists():
logging.info(f"[DEPLOY] Creating config file {self.config_file}")
shutil.copy(Path(__file__).parent / "default.spec", self.config_file)
else:
print(f"Using existing config file {config_file}")
self.parser.read(self.config_file)
self.dry_run = dry_run
# set source_file
self.source_file = Path(
self.set_or_fetch(config_property_val=source_file, config_property_key="input_file")
)
# set python path
self.python_path = Path(
self.set_or_fetch(
config_property_val=python_exe,
config_property_key="python_path",
config_property_group="python",
)
)
self.project_dir = None
if self.get_value("app", "project_dir"):
self.project_dir = Path(self.get_value("app", "project_dir")).absolute()
else:
self._find_and_set_project_dir()
self.project_data: ProjectData = None
if self.get_value("app", "project_file"):
project_file = Path(self.get_value("app", "project_file")).absolute()
self.project_data = ProjectData(project_file=project_file)
else:
self._find_and_set_project_file()
self.qml_files = []
config_qml_files = self.get_value("qt", "qml_files")
if config_qml_files and self.project_dir:
self.qml_files = [Path(self.project_dir) / file for file in config_qml_files.split(",")]
else:
self._find_and_set_qml_files()
self.excluded_qml_plugins = []
if self.get_value("qt", "excluded_qml_plugins"):
self.excluded_qml_plugins = self.get_value("qt", "excluded_qml_plugins").split(",")
else:
self._find_and_set_excluded_qml_plugins()
def update_config(self):
logging.info(f"[DEPLOY] Creating {self.config_file}")
with open(self.config_file, "w+") as config_file:
self.parser.write(config_file, space_around_delimiters=True)
def set_value(self, section: str, key: str, new_value: str):
try:
current_value = self.get_value(section, key)
if current_value != new_value:
self.parser.set(section, key, new_value)
except configparser.NoOptionError:
logging.warning(f"[DEPLOY] key {key} does not exist")
except configparser.NoSectionError:
logging.warning(f"[DEPLOY] section {section} does not exist")
def get_value(self, section: str, key: str):
try:
return self.parser.get(section, key)
except configparser.NoOptionError:
logging.warning(f"[DEPLOY] key {key} does not exist")
except configparser.NoSectionError:
logging.warning(f"[DEPLOY] section {section} does not exist")
def set_or_fetch(self, config_property_val, config_property_key, config_property_group="app"):
"""
Write to config_file if 'config_property_key' is known without config_file
Fetch and return from config_file if 'config_property_key' is unknown, but
config_file exists
Otherwise, raise an exception
"""
if config_property_val:
self.set_value(config_property_group, config_property_key, str(config_property_val))
return config_property_val
elif self.get_value(config_property_group, config_property_key):
return self.get_value(config_property_group, config_property_key)
else:
logging.exception(
f"[DEPLOY] No {config_property_key} specified in config file or as cli option"
)
raise
@property
def qml_files(self):
return self._qml_files
@qml_files.setter
def qml_files(self, qml_files):
self._qml_files = qml_files
@property
def project_dir(self):
return self._project_dir
@project_dir.setter
def project_dir(self, project_dir):
self._project_dir = project_dir
@property
def source_file(self):
return self._source_file
@source_file.setter
def source_file(self, source_file):
self._source_file = source_file
@property
def python_path(self):
return self._python_path
@python_path.setter
def python_path(self, python_path):
self._python_path = python_path
@property
def excluded_qml_plugins(self):
return self._excluded_qml_plugins
@excluded_qml_plugins.setter
def excluded_qml_plugins(self, excluded_qml_plugins):
self._excluded_qml_plugins = excluded_qml_plugins
def _find_and_set_qml_files(self):
"""Fetches all the qml_files in the folder and sets them if the
field qml_files is empty in the config_dir"""
if self.project_data:
qml_files = self.project_data.qml_files
for sub_project_file in self.project_data.sub_projects_files:
qml_files.extend(ProjectData(project_file=sub_project_file).qml_files)
self.qml_files = qml_files
else:
qml_files_temp = None
source_file = (
Path(self.get_value("app", "input_file"))
if self.get_value("app", "input_file")
else None
)
python_exe = (
Path(self.get_value("python", "python_path"))
if self.get_value("python", "python_path")
else None
)
if source_file and python_exe:
if not self.qml_files:
qml_files_temp = list(source_file.parent.glob("**/*.qml"))
# add all QML files, excluding the ones shipped with installed PySide6
# The QML files shipped with PySide6 gets added if venv is used,
# because of recursive glob
if python_exe.parent.parent == source_file.parent:
# python venv path is inside the main source dir
qml_files_temp = list(
set(qml_files_temp) - set(python_exe.parent.parent.rglob("*.qml"))
)
if len(qml_files_temp) > 500:
if "site-packages" in str(qml_files_temp[-1]):
logging.warning(
"You seem to include a lot of QML files from a \
local virtual env. Are they intended?"
)
else:
logging.warning(
"You seem to include a lot of QML files. \
Are they intended?"
)
if qml_files_temp:
extra_qml_files = [Path(file) for file in qml_files_temp]
self.qml_files.extend(extra_qml_files)
if self.qml_files:
self.set_value(
"qt",
"qml_files",
",".join([str(file.relative_to(self.project_dir)) for file in self.qml_files]),
)
logging.info("[DEPLOY] QML files identified and set in config_file")
def _find_and_set_project_dir(self):
# there is no other way to find the project_dir than assume it is the parent directory
# of source_file
self.project_dir = self.source_file.parent
# update input_file path
logging.info("[DEPLOY] Update input_file path")
self.set_value("app", "input_file", str(self.source_file.relative_to(self.project_dir)))
logging.info("[DEPLOY] Update project_dir path")
if self.project_dir != Path.cwd():
self.set_value("app", "project_dir", str(self.project_dir))
else:
self.set_value("app", "project_dir", str(self.project_dir.relative_to(Path.cwd())))
def _find_and_set_project_file(self):
logging.info("[DEPLOY] Searching for .pyproject file")
if self.project_dir:
files = list(self.project_dir.glob("*.pyproject"))
else:
logging.exception("[DEPLOY] Project directory not set in config file")
raise
if not files:
logging.info("[DEPLOY] No .pyproject file found. Project file not set")
elif len(files) > 1:
logging.warning("DEPLOY: More that one .pyproject files found. Project file not set")
raise
else:
self.project_data = ProjectData(files[0])
self.set_value("app", "project_file", str(files[0].relative_to(self.project_dir)))
logging.info(f"[DEPLOY] Project file {files[0]} found and set in config file")
def _find_and_set_excluded_qml_plugins(self):
if self.qml_files:
included_qml_modules = set(run_qmlimportscanner(qml_files=self.qml_files,
dry_run=self.dry_run))
self.excluded_qml_plugins = EXCLUDED_QML_PLUGINS.difference(included_qml_modules)
# needed for dry_run testing
self.excluded_qml_plugins = sorted(self.excluded_qml_plugins)
if self.excluded_qml_plugins:
self.set_value("qt", "excluded_qml_plugins", ",".join(self.excluded_qml_plugins))
